Software Engineer

3 weeks ago


Winnipeg, Manitoba, Canada Manitoba Hydro International Full time

Job Summary

We are seeking a skilled Software Developer to join our team at Manitoba Hydro International. As a key member of our software development group, you will work independently or as part of a team to design, develop, and maintain software products that meet the needs of our customers and internal engineering users.

Key Responsibilities

  1. Develop and maintain software products using industry-standard design and development processes.
  2. Collaborate with other team members to ensure that software products meet the required standards and are delivered on time.
  3. Participate in requirements gathering and maintain an understanding of the application domain for which the product is applied.
  4. Work closely with other members of the software products group to ensure that software products are developed and maintained in accordance with established processes and best practices.
  5. Author and maintain progress documents describing project work and communicate progress to other group members as required.

Requirements

  1. A four-year degree in Computer Science or Computer Engineering from a university of recognized standing.
  2. Experience with C++, C#, and Python programming languages.
  3. Knowledge of Git or similar version control systems.
  4. Experience working with Microsoft Foundation Class and/or Microsoft.NET Frameworks.
  5. Knowledge of SQL and XML database technologies.
  6. Demonstrated ability to analyze, plan, control, and make decisions related to the development of engineering-oriented computer systems and applications.
  7. Self-motivated, with demonstrated initiative to work in a fast-paced, open environment.
  8. Strong work ethic, ability to work in a team, and willingness to learn new skills.
  9. Excellent communication skills (written and oral).
  10. Solid understanding and experience developing Object Oriented solutions.
  11. Excellent organizational and time management skills with emphasis on detail.

Work Environment

This is a full-time, fixed-term contract position with a contract length of 24 months. The successful candidate will work in a dynamic and fast-paced environment with a team of experienced software developers.

Language

English is the primary language of communication in this role.

Location

This position is based in person at our office location.


  • Software Engineer

    3 days ago


    Winnipeg, Manitoba, Canada Apollo Homes Ltd Full time

    Job Title: Software EngineerThe software engineer will be responsible for the design, development, and maintenance of software applications. The engineer will work closely with the development team to ensure that software meets the required specifications.Key Responsibilities:1. Design and develop software applications using Java and Python programming...


  • Winnipeg, Manitoba, Canada Tim Hortons Full time

    Job Title: **Software EngineerWe are seeking a skilled Software Engineer to join our team at {company}. As a Software Engineer, you will be responsible for designing, developing, and testing software applications.Key Responsibilities:Design and develop software applications using various programming languagesCollaborate with cross-functional teams to...

  • Software Engineer

    2 weeks ago


    Winnipeg, Manitoba, Canada NEO BIZ SOLUTIONS INC. Full time

    Job Title: Software EngineerAbout the Role:We are seeking a skilled Software Engineer to join our team at NEO BIZ SOLUTIONS INC. As a Software Engineer, you will be responsible for designing, developing, and testing software applications.Key Responsibilities:Design and develop software applications using C++, Java, JavaScript, and Python.Collaborate with...


  • Winnipeg, Manitoba, Canada BMC Market Full time

    About the Role:This is a new opportunity to join our company as a highly skilled Software Engineer.As a member of our team, you will be responsible for designing, developing, and maintaining our software applications. You will work closely with our cross-functional teams to deliver high-quality software solutions that meet the needs of our customers.The...

  • Software Engineer

    1 month ago


    Winnipeg, Manitoba, Canada Magellan Aerospace Corporation Full time

    Intermediate Software Developer OpportunityMagellan Aerospace Corporation is seeking an experienced Intermediate Software Developer to join our development team at our manufacturing hub in Winnipeg, Manitoba.Key Responsibilities:Develop software solutions to complex customer requirementsDesign and implement software architecture to meet customer...

  • Software Engineer

    1 month ago


    Winnipeg, Manitoba, Canada Magellan Aerospace Corporation Full time

    Intermediate Software Developer OpportunityMagellan Aerospace Corporation is seeking an experienced Intermediate Software Developer to join our development team at our manufacturing hub in Winnipeg, Manitoba.Key Responsibilities:Develop software solutions to complex customer requirementsDesign and implement software architecture to meet customer...

  • Software Engineer

    1 month ago


    Winnipeg, Manitoba, Canada Magellan Aerospace Corporation Full time

    Intermediate Software Developer OpportunityMagellan Aerospace Corporation is seeking an experienced Intermediate Software Developer to join our development team at our manufacturing hub in Winnipeg, Manitoba.Key Responsibilities:Develop software solutions to complex customer requirementsDesign and implement software architecture to meet customer...

  • Software Engineer

    1 month ago


    Winnipeg, Manitoba, Canada Magellan Aerospace Corporation Full time

    Intermediate Software Developer OpportunityMagellan Aerospace Corporation is seeking an experienced Intermediate Software Developer to join our development team at our manufacturing hub in Winnipeg, Manitoba.Key Responsibilities:Develop software solutions to complex customer requirementsDesign and implement software architecture to meet customer...

  • Software Engineer

    1 month ago


    Winnipeg, Manitoba, Canada Magellan Aerospace Corporation Full time

    Intermediate Software Developer OpportunityMagellan Aerospace Corporation is seeking an experienced Intermediate Software Developer to join our development team at our manufacturing hub in Winnipeg, Manitoba.Key Responsibilities:Develop software solutions to complex customer requirementsDesign and implement software architecture to meet customer...

  • Software Engineer

    1 month ago


    Winnipeg, Manitoba, Canada Magellan Aerospace Corporation Full time

    Intermediate Software Developer OpportunityMagellan Aerospace Corporation is seeking an experienced Intermediate Software Developer to join our development team at our manufacturing hub in Winnipeg, Manitoba.Key Responsibilities:Develop software solutions to complex customer requirementsDesign and implement software architecture to meet customer...

  • Software Engineer

    3 days ago


    Winnipeg, Manitoba, Canada RE-NU Hair Salon and Spa Full time

    About the Role:We're seeking a skilled Software Engineer to join our team at {company}. As a key member of our technology department, you will be responsible for designing, developing, and maintaining software applications that meet the needs of our business.Responsibilities:* Design and develop software applications using a variety of programming languages...

  • Software Engineer

    4 weeks ago


    Winnipeg, Manitoba, Canada NEO BIZ SOLUTIONS INC. Full time

    Software Developer Job DescriptionWe are seeking a skilled Software Developer to join our team at NEO BIZ SOLUTIONS INC.Key Responsibilities:Design, develop, and test software applications using C++, Java, JavaScript, and Python.Maintain and improve existing software systems to ensure optimal performance and efficiency.Collaborate with cross-functional teams...

  • Software Engineer

    4 weeks ago


    Winnipeg, Manitoba, Canada NEO BIZ SOLUTIONS INC. Full time

    Software Developer Job DescriptionWe are seeking a skilled Software Developer to join our team at NEO BIZ SOLUTIONS INC.Key Responsibilities:Design, develop, and test software applications using C++, Java, JavaScript, and Python.Maintain and improve existing software systems to ensure optimal performance and efficiency.Collaborate with cross-functional teams...

  • Software Engineer

    4 days ago


    Winnipeg, Manitoba, Canada MANITOBA INC. Full time

    As a Software Engineer at {company}, you will be responsible for designing, developing, and testing software applications. Your primary focus will be on building scalable and efficient software solutions that meet the needs of our customers.Key Responsibilities:Design and develop software applications using a variety of programming languages and...

  • Software Engineer

    4 days ago


    Winnipeg, Manitoba, Canada Apna Spicy Hut Full time

    Job Overview:We are seeking a skilled Software Engineer to join our team. The ideal candidate will have a strong foundation in computer science and experience with software development methodologies. The successful candidate will work closely with cross-functional teams to design, develop, and deploy software solutions.

  • Software Engineer

    1 month ago


    Winnipeg, Manitoba, Canada Magellan Aerospace Corporation Full time

    Intermediate Software DeveloperMagellan Aerospace is a global leader in the aerospace industry, providing complex assemblies and systems solutions to aircraft and engine manufacturers, and defence and space agencies worldwide.We are seeking an Intermediate Software Developer to join our development team at our manufacturing hub in Winnipeg, Manitoba.Key...

  • Software Engineer

    1 month ago


    Winnipeg, Manitoba, Canada Magellan Aerospace Corporation Full time

    Intermediate Software DeveloperMagellan Aerospace is a global leader in the aerospace industry, providing complex assemblies and systems solutions to aircraft and engine manufacturers, and defence and space agencies worldwide.We are seeking an Intermediate Software Developer to join our development team at our manufacturing hub in Winnipeg, Manitoba.Key...


  • Winnipeg, Manitoba, Canada L&C Auto Brothers Inc. Full time

    We are seeking a skilled Software Engineer II to join our team at {company}.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ining our software systems.The ideal candidate will have a strong foundation in computer science and software engineering principles, with a passion for building scalable and...

  • Software Engineer

    3 days ago


    Winnipeg, Manitoba, Canada Boston Pizza Henderson Full time

    About the Role:As a skilled Software Engineer, you will be responsible for designing, developing, and testing software applications. This is a fantastic opportunity to work with a talented team and contribute to the creation of innovative solutions.Key Responsibilities:Design and develop software applications using various programming languages and...


  • Winnipeg, Manitoba, Canada Standard Aero Full time

    Software Development EngineerStandardAero is seeking a skilled Software Development Engineer to design and implement data acquisition and control systems for testing gas turbine engines. As a key member of our Central Engineering team, you will work with computer, electrical, and mechanical engineers to create systems that are accurate, maintainable, and...